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Marketing Campaigns: Support the planning and execution of product launches, seasonal campaigns and promotional activity. Coordinate campaign delivery across email, website, paid media, social and affiliate channels. Work closely with our design and content team to ensure campaigns are delivered on time and to a high standard. Help bring new marketing ideas and initiatives to life.
  • Email & SMS (Klaviyo): Manage and optimise our Klaviyo email and SMS programme. Plan and execute campaign communications. Refine customer segmentation and personalisation. Continuously optimise existing lifecycle journeys. Test creative, messaging and offers to improve performance. Monitor deliverability, engagement and revenue.
  • Partnerships: Support the management and growth of our affiliate programme. Help manage our loyalty programme and referral initiatives. Build relationships with partners and identify new collaboration opportunities.
  • Paid Media: Act as the day-to-day contact for our paid media agency. Coordinate creative briefs and campaign requirements. Participate in weekly performance reviews. Support landing page and promotional planning.
  • Reporting & Commercial Insights: Produce weekly and monthly marketing reports. Analyse campaign and channel performance. Identify trends, opportunities and areas for improvement. Support commercial planning with actionable insights.
  • Innovation: Keep up to date with developments in eCommerce and digital marketing. Bring fresh ideas, tools and best practices to the team. Look for opportunities to improve efficiency, customer experience and marketing performance.
